I am a life-long Dolphin fan, and can say without hesitation that JT's heart just wasn't in it. It's a shame because he was the best Miami player since Marino. First off, I think it was a huge mistake to trade a second round pick for a 30something player (thanks for that, btw :) ), second, a huge mistake to move him to the left side.

I thought he was done a disservice in Miami when they went away from the 4-3 and tried to use him as a LB/free lancer. Why would they fool with the success he had as a RDE? He was so damn good playing in space out of a 3 point stance on the QB's weak side. I thought he was so pure in that "Chris Doleman/Richard Dent" mold. What were they trying to turn him into? LT?

Before we start making this into a bad deal, let's first look at the circumstances that brought Jason to Washington in the first place. If it wasn't for the injury to Daniels, Taylor would not be here. Vinny made the deal out of desperation. Even with a healthy Daniels, the Skins were week on the D-line. Bringing in a proven commodity, who was known as staying healthy (113 straight starts), was a smart move; it just did not pan out like most people expected. Who could have every known that Jason would get hurt in preseason, and then later have a blood build up in his calf. That was a fluke if I ever saw one. So know the facts before calling this a bad move. Jason need to stay here and prove that he is the player the Redskins thought they were getting (a Pro Bowler).
